Rich7sena Posted March 14, 2020 Share Posted March 14, 2020 My Ruggs comp is Brandin Cooks. He's not Tyreek Hill. Hill accelerates like a Tesla. That said, Cooks is a very good player and arguably the most important offensive player on that team not named Jared Goff. Ruggs would instantly change the dynamic of the offense from a 5-15 yard offense to a 5-25 yard offense. He stretches the field in both directions (horizontally with jet sweeps and vertically with deep routes).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
BayRaider Posted March 14, 2020 Share Posted March 14, 2020 (edited) Seen some mocks we select CeeDee at 12 over both Jeudy and Ruggs. I will guarantee that won’t happen with Carr as QB (Lamb over Jeudy). 1) We need speed at the position 2) Lamb biggest strength will be contested catches, he’s not going to be consistently open, but if you throw to him he is gonna come down with most of these 50/50 balls. Problem is Carr isn’t gonna throw those and Mayock knows this. Not only is Jeudy my favorite WR in the class, he’s also the best fit for Carr. Jeudy will be wide open a lottt.
